Pete's Famous Restaurant
For American diner fare only steps away from campus during intersession or when you just can’t face the Deece, Pete’s is your best bet. Pete’s serves breakfast all day and will even pack up takeout for you to shelp back to your pals at Vassar. The prices are unbelievably reasonable and the service is generally quick. Breakfast specials are served until 11:00 a.m. daily and include choices such as toast, pancakes, muffins, home fries, eggs, assorted breakfast meats, juice and coffee. Specials will run you between $3.95 and $5.35. An egg or cheese sandwich is $1.75.
Besides breakfast, there is a selection of subs, sandwiches, salads and seafood (mostly fried) available. Pete’s is not for the conscientious dieter but it definitely fits the bill for those who want to grab something quick to go or who need sustenance for an all-nighter. I tried Pete’s last winter break to save myself the horror of my own scrambled eggs and had to share with friends: Pete’s portions are huge. The diner is open from 6:00 a.m. daily and accepts vCard.
